About

Goodbye Mom! or Bye Mom! refers to a two-panel image macro featuring Cereal Guy in the first panel and a stick figure with Yao Ming Face riding a tricycle or an All-Terrain Kart from Fortnite in the second panel. Initially circulated unironically, starting in 2018 the macro has been used as an ironic addition to images showing map locations.

Origin

The exact origin of "Goodbye Mom!" macro is currently unconfirmed. On March 12th, 2012, Taringa[1] user yusukeUB uploaded the earliest copy of "Goodbye Mom!" meme currently available online. The post contained a two-panel rage comics reaction to an image of a road sign saying "Hankunamatata."



Spread

In the following years, the macro appeared in various memes posted on Memedroid[2], Memecenter[3] and other online platforms (examples shown below).



Ironic Use

On Saturday 6th, 2018, Reddit user IsiTheDoge posted an image of unknown origin showing a photoshopped road sign saying "fortnite city" to /r/okbuddyretard subreddit.[4] The post gained over 500 upvotes in five months. On the same day, Redditor Fl00DLE uploaded the image to /r/comedycemetery[5] subreddit, claiming that the meme originated on Instagram.[6]



On October 14th, 2018, Redditor Despacitoman88 posted another version of the meme to the /r/okbuddyretard[7] subreddit. The post gained over 8,000 upvotes in four months.



In the following months, ironic memes utilizing the format were posted in /r/okbuddyretard[8] subreddit and Instagram[9].
